| def flag_set(flags = None, features = None, not_features = None, **kwargs): | |
| """Extension to flag_set which allows for a "simple" form. | |
| The simple form allows specifying flags as a simple list instead of a flag_group | |
| if enable_if or expand_if semantics are not required. | |
| Similarly, the simple form allows passing features/not_features if they are a simple | |
| list of semantically "and" features. | |
| (i.e. "asan" and "dbg", rather than "asan" or "dbg") | |
| Args: | |
| flags: list, set of flags | |
| features: list, set of features required to be enabled. | |
| not_features: list, set of features required to not be enabled. | |
| **kwargs: The rest of the args for flag_set. | |
| Returns: | |
| flag_set | |
| """ | |
| if flags: | |
| if kwargs.get("flag_groups"): | |
| fail("Cannot set flags and flag_groups") | |
| else: | |
| kwargs["flag_groups"] = [flag_group(flags = flags)] | |
| if features or not_features: | |
| if kwargs.get("with_features"): | |
| fail("Cannot set features/not_feature and with_features") | |
| kwargs["with_features"] = [with_feature_set( | |
| features = features or [], | |
| not_features = not_features or [], | |
| )] | |
| return _flag_set(**kwargs) | |

| features = [ | |
| # This set of magic "feature"s are important configuration information for blaze. | |
| feature(name = "no_legacy_features", enabled = True), | |
| feature( | |
| name = "has_configured_linker_path", | |
| enabled = True, | |
| ), | |
| # Blaze requests this feature by default, but we don't care. | |
| feature(name = "dependency_file"), | |
| # Blaze requests this feature by default, but we don't care. | |
| feature(name = "random_seed"), | |
| # Formerly "needsPic" attribute | |
| feature(name = "supports_pic", enabled = False), | |
| # Blaze requests this feature by default. | |
| # Blaze also tests if this feature is supported, before setting the "pic" build-variable. | |
| feature(name = "pic"), | |
| # Blaze requests this feature by default. | |
| # Blaze also tests if this feature is supported before setting preprocessor_defines | |
| # (...but why?) | |
| feature(name = "preprocessor_defines"), | |
| # Blaze requests this feature by default. | |
| # Blaze also tests if this feature is supported before setting includes. (...but why?) | |
| feature(name = "include_paths"), | |
| # Blaze tests if this feature is enabled in order to create implicit | |
| # "nodeps" .so outputs from cc_library rules. | |
| feature(name = "supports_dynamic_linker", enabled = False), | |
| # Blaze requests this feature when linking a cc_binary which is | |
| # "dynamic" aka linked against nodeps-dynamic-library cc_library | |
| # outputs. | |
| feature(name = "dynamic_linking_mode"), | |
| #### Configuration features | |
| feature( | |
| name = "crosstool_cpu", | |
| enabled = True, | |
| implies = ["crosstool_cpu_" + target_cpu], | |
| ), | |
| feature( | |
| name = "crosstool_cpu_asmjs", | |
| provides = ["variant:crosstool_cpu"], | |
| ), | |
| feature( | |
| name = "crosstool_cpu_wasm", | |
| provides = ["variant:crosstool_cpu"], | |
| ), | |
| # These 3 features will be automatically enabled by blaze in the | |
| # corresponding build mode. | |
| feature( | |
| name = "opt", | |
| provides = ["variant:crosstool_build_mode"], | |
| ), | |
| feature( | |
| name = "dbg", | |
| provides = ["variant:crosstool_build_mode"], | |
| ), | |
| feature( | |
| name = "fastbuild", | |
| provides = ["variant:crosstool_build_mode"], | |
| ), | |
| # Feature to prevent 'command line too long' issues | |
| feature( | |
| name = "archive_param_file", | |
| enabled = True, | |
| ), | |
| feature( | |
| name = "compiler_param_file", | |
| enabled = True, | |
| ), | |
| #### User-settable features | |
| # Set if enabling exceptions. | |
| feature(name = "exceptions"), | |
| # Set if enabling wasm_exceptions. | |
| feature(name = "wasm_exceptions"), | |
| # This feature overrides the default optimization to prefer execution speed | |
| # over binary size (like clang -O3). | |
| feature( | |
| name = "optimized_for_speed", | |
| provides = ["variant:crosstool_optimization_mode"], | |
| ), | |
| # This feature overrides the default optimization to prefer binary size over | |
| # execution speed (like clang -Oz). | |
| feature( | |
| name = "optimized_for_size", | |
| provides = ["variant:crosstool_optimization_mode"], | |
| ), | |
| # Convenience aliases / alt-spellings. | |
| feature( | |
| name = "optimize_for_speed", | |
| implies = ["optimized_for_speed"], | |
| ), | |
| feature( | |
| name = "optimize_for_size", | |
| implies = ["optimized_for_size"], | |
| ), | |
| # This feature allows easier use of profiling tools by preserving mangled | |
| # C++ names. This does everything profiling_funcs does and more. | |
| feature(name = "profiling"), | |
| # This feature emits only enough debug info for function names to appear | |
| # in profiles. | |
| feature(name = "profiling_funcs"), | |
| # This feature allows source maps to be generated. | |
| feature( | |
| name = "source_maps", | |
| implies = ["full_debug_info"], | |
| ), | |
| feature( | |
| name = "dwarf_debug_info", | |
| implies = ["profiling"], | |
| ), | |
| # Turns on full debug info (-g3). | |
| feature(name = "full_debug_info"), | |
| # Enables the use of "Emscripten" Pthread implementation. | |
| # https://kripken.github.io/emscripten-site/docs/porting/pthreads.html | |
| # https://github.com/kripken/emscripten/wiki/Pthreads-with-WebAssembly | |
| feature(name = "use_pthreads"), | |
| # If enabled, the runtime will exit when main() completes. | |
| feature(name = "exit_runtime"), | |
| # Primarily for toolchain maintainers: | |
| feature(name = "emcc_debug"), | |
| feature(name = "emcc_debug_link"), | |
| feature( | |
| name = "llvm_backend", | |
| requires = [feature_set(features = ["crosstool_cpu_wasm"])], | |
| enabled = True, | |
| ), | |
| # Remove once flag is flipped. | |
| # See https://github.com/bazelbuild/bazel/issues/7687 | |
| feature( | |
| name = "do_not_split_linking_cmdline", | |
| ), | |
| # Adds simd support, only available with the llvm backend. | |
| feature( | |
| name = "wasm_simd", | |
| requires = [feature_set(features = ["llvm_backend"])], | |
| ), | |
| # Adds relaxed-simd support, only available with the llvm backend. | |
| feature( | |
| name = "wasm_relaxed_simd", | |
| requires = [feature_set(features = ["llvm_backend"])], | |
| ), | |
| feature( | |
| name = "precise_long_double_printf", | |
| enabled = True, | |
| ), | |
| feature( | |
| name = "wasm_warnings_as_errors", | |
| enabled = False, | |
| ), | |
| # ASan and UBSan. See also: | |
| # https://emscripten.org/docs/debugging/Sanitizers.html | |
| feature(name = "wasm_asan"), | |
| feature(name = "wasm_ubsan"), | |
| feature( | |
| name = "output_format_js", | |
| enabled = True, | |
| ), | |
| feature( | |
| name = "wasm_standalone", | |
| ), | |
| ] | |
